Abstract:
We report key advances in the area of GW calculations, review the available software implementations and define standardization criteria to render the comparison between GW calculations from different codes meaningful, and identify future major challenges in the area of quasiparticle calculations. This Topical Issue should be a reference point for further developments in the field. Copyright EDP Sciences, SIF, Springer-Verlag Berlin Heidelberg 2012
